    Re: Opinions wanted .... please.........

    Quote Originally Posted by stoinkythepig View Post
    I never cared for the Azaros. For me, they would cup badly and howl like mad while leaned over in corners. Reminded me of the old Dunlop D205s
    Azaros were the first tire that I has luck with for not scalloping, you have to run Avon's recomended pressure, not the manufacturer's

    the VBD carcass requires higher pressure

    Re: Opinions wanted .... please.........

    Believe me, I have tried nearly every brand you can imagine...74000 miles on an ST2 and 10k on my Multistrada. I get about 5k on any tire I have put on and I have never exceeded the performance envelope on the street. So, my conclusion, is buy the least expensive name brand that's available.

    And yes, some dealers won't mount tires they don't sell...others will but you may as well have bought the tires from them by the time the charge what they charge. Its understandable...they are in business to make money!
